THE COUNCIL SERVES AS THE BACKBONE OF THE NETWORK FOR SEVERAL COLLABORATIVE PROGRAMS, PROVIDING ADMINISTRATIVE AND PROGRAMMATIC OVERSIGHT, DEVELOPING AND MAINTAINING CONTRACTUAL RELATIONSHIPS, AND PROVIDING PERFORMANCE MANAGEMENT & QUALITY IMPROVEMENT. THE COUNCIL SERVES AS A STATEWIDE PROVIDER NETWORK FOR MULTIPLE PROGRAMS.

What Human Services executives earn in Connecticut
Comparable human services organizations in Connecticut pay their highest-earning executive a median of $121,972.
These are human services sector-wide figures, not this organization's reported pay. Based on 111 organizations across 111 filings (2022 – 2023).
